Description

H-Ala-Thr-Oh is a protected dipeptide building block, specifically L-Alanine-L-Threonine, where the C-terminal carboxylic acid is protected as a tert-butyl ester. This compound is a critical intermediate in the synthesis of complex peptides and peptidomimetics, offering precise control over sequence and stereochemistry. It is primarily utilized by research institutions and pharmaceutical companies engaged in drug discovery, development of bioactive peptides, and proteomics research.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at 15-25°C. This material is hygroscopic (moisture-sensitive); keep the original container s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ation. For long-term storage, consider storing at -20°C.
